I have a spectrum analyzer (Advantest U4941) with a PCMCIA slot. Can I use
a PCMCIA/USB adaptor card and send data to a USB memory stick?

I have a spectrum analyzer (Advantest U4941) with a PCMCIA slot. Can I use
a PCMCIA/USB adaptor card and send data to a USB memory stick?
If the analyzer expects to talk to ATA/IDE devices (compact flash,
PCMCIA IDE drives, etc) then this should work. If it expects a linear
flash memory card (less common), then it won't.
